Update:
My new title came in the mail yesterday with the new correct serial number that’s on the plates, not the one that was on the engine block like the one I had first. No questions asked, and surprisingly no fees.  
Yay!  Now I can order new serial number plates!

I sent in the correction form March 15th so it hasn’t even been 30 days yet.
